Is korma curry paste Vegan?

No. This product is not vegan as it lists 1 ingredient that derives from animals and 2 ingredients that could could derive from animals depending on the source.

Ingredients

tomato purée from concentrate, water, sugar, rapeseed oil, desiccated coconut (6%), creamed coconut (4%), ground coriander (4%), ground ginger, ground cumin, salt, acidity regulator (lactic acid), turmeric, garlic powder, paprika, coriander leaf, preservative (potassium sorbate), egg yolk powder, chilli powder, stabiliser (xanthan gum), ground oregano. allergy advice! for allergens, see ingredients in bold. no artificial colours, flavours or hydrogenated fat. packed in the u.k. for asda stores limited, leeds ls11 5ad for best before: see lid negelarian med ego

What is a Vegan diet?

A vegan diet excludes all animal-derived foods, including meat, poultry, fish, dairy, eggs, and honey. It focuses on plant-based sources such as fruits, vegetables, grains, legumes, nuts, and seeds. Many people choose veganism for ethical, environmental, or health reasons. When well-planned, it provides sufficient protein, fiber, and antioxidants, though supplementation or fortified foods may be needed for nutrients like vitamin B12, iron, and omega-3 fatty acids. Vegan diets are associated with lower risks of heart disease and improved digestion but require mindfulness to ensure balanced and complete nutrition.
